Type YT-1000L Electro-pneumatic valve positioner is used for operation of pneumatic linear valve actuators by means of electrical controller or control system with an analog output signal of DC 4 to 20 mA or split Ranges.

The valve positioner is divided into pneumatic valve positioner, electro-pneumatic valve positioner and intelligent valve positioner according to the structure.

The electro pneumatic valve positioner is the main accessory of the control valve. The valve positioner is usually used in conjunction with the pneumatic control valve.

YT1000L valve positioner receives the output signal of the regulator and then uses its The output signal is used to control the pneumatic control valve.

The electric signal is converted into electromagnetic force inside the electro valve positioner, and then the air signal is output to the toggle Control valve. The intelligent electro valve positioner converts the current signal output from the control room into the gas signal for driving the regulating valve. According to the friction force of the valve stem when the regulating valve is working, the unbalanced force generated by the fluctuation of the medium pressure is offset, and the valve opening corresponds to the control The current signal output by the chamber can be configured intelligently to set the corresponding parameters to achieve the purpose of improving the performance of the control valve.
